brew formula on linux requires gcc

Pouring puma-dev from a bottle shouldn't require gcc. Low impact as I expect most people that have homebrew on linux also have brew install gcc'd in the past.

$ date; uname -a; brew -v
Thu Feb  4 09:10:57 AM EST 2021
Linux osboxes 5.8.0-25-generic #26-Ubuntu SMP Thu Oct 15 10:30:38 UTC 2020 x86_64 x86_64 x86_64 GNU/Linux
Homebrew 2.7.7
Homebrew/linuxbrew-core (git revision 3e22a8; last commit 2021-02-04)

$ brew install -dv puma/puma/puma-dev
/home/linuxbrew/.linuxbrew/Homebrew/Library/Homebrew/brew.rb (Formulary::TapLoader): loading /home/linuxbrew/.linuxbrew/Homebrew/Library/Taps/puma/homebrew-puma/puma-dev.rb
==> Installing puma-dev from puma/puma
==> Downloading https://github.com/puma/puma-dev/releases/download/v0.15.2/puma-dev-0.15.2-linux-amd64.tar.gz
/usr/bin/curl --disable --globoff --show-error --user-agent Linuxbrew/2.7.7\ \(Linux\;\ x86_64\ Ubuntu\ 20.10\)\ curl/7.68.0 --header Accept-Language:\ en --retry 3 --location --silent --head --request GET https://github.com/puma/puma-dev/releases/download/v0.15.2/puma-dev-0.15.2-linux-amd64.tar.gz
Already downloaded: /home/osboxes/.cache/Homebrew/downloads/57fcc318f4953cf45412b788a444f7a23dc90995f9c3f412e32dc29825e7b1f2--puma-dev-0.15.2-linux-amd64.tar.gz
==> Verifying checksum for '57fcc318f4953cf45412b788a444f7a23dc90995f9c3f412e32dc29825e7b1f2--puma-dev-0.15.2-linux-amd64.tar.gz'
Error: The following formula cannot be installed from bottle and must be
built from source.
  puma-dev
Install Clang or run `brew install gcc`.

Deprecated <<-EOS.undent

Warning: Calling <<-EOS.undent is deprecated!
Use <<~EOS instead.
/usr/local/Homebrew/Library/Taps/puma/homebrew-puma/puma-dev.rb:30:in `caveats'
Please report this to the puma/puma tap!

Gotta say I don't really know how to address this because <<~ is only available in Ruby 2.3 so it seems a bit wasteful to detect it or check the Ruby version just to avoid this warning.
